COMMUNITY STEWARDSHIP AWARD PRESENTATION Chris Straw was nominated posthumously for his impactful leadership in advocating against freighter anchorages in the Southern Gulf Islands. Margy Gilmour accepted the award on behalf of Chris Straw and thanked Islands Trust for recognizing Chris’ dedication to protect the marine environment. Ted Fullerton, a representative of Gabriolans Against Freighter Anchorages Society (GAFA) thanked everyone for awarding Chris posthumously and recognized his invaluable contribution.
